Do halibut have scales? General description: Halibut are more elongated than most flatfishes, the width being about one-third the length. Small scales are imbedded in the skin. WebHalibut is a type of fish that typically has a white flesh with a mildly sweet taste. It is a popular fish to eat, especially in sushi. Halibut can grow up to 8 feet long and weigh up to 400 pounds. The fish has a large, flat body with a small head and tall fins. The long, firm fins help the fish swim in deep waters. Halibut are a group of three species of large flatfish in the right-eye flounder family. They include the Pacific, Atlantic and Greenland halibut.
